1994 Z71 Surging, Running Lean

Guys, I have a 1994 Z71 extended cab. It sat for several months before I bought it and I have fixed quite a few things so far but I have one major problem I can't seem to diagnose and it is getting worse over time. I first noticed this probelm after I had all the tranny removed to replace all seals/gaskets. The longer the pickup sits the more likely this problem is to occur. If I drive it every day it usually won't happen. But when it does, it starts with with the parking brake light illuminating. Then it will begin to surge at low-mid rpm and completely lose power at high rpm. If I then let off the gas it will shift and sometimes resolve after a few times during the drive and sometimes continue on even through idle. Sometimes the speedometer will jump around sporadically. The only other info I have for you is it is throwing a running lean code, the temp gauge needle hardly budges from its original position, and occasionally I can smell gasoline outside of the vehicle. I have not been able to trace the smell but it is definately gas and nothing is dripping on the pavement. Thanks for the help!
